The restore may have the file that you deleted between the two backups. Rsync can streamline file transfers over networked connections and add robustness to local directory syncing. The flexibility of Rsync makes it a good choice for many completely different file-level operations. Also, add -a (archive mode) to ensure recordsdata are backed up recursively whereas preserving their permissions, timestamps, and symbolic hyperlinks. Rsync stands for distant sync which was written by Andrew Tridgell and Paul Mackerras again in 1996. It’s one of the most used ‘tools’ in the UNIX world and almost a standard for syncing data.

The Means To Use Rsync To Again Up Data
  • Short for Distant SYNC, rsync is a CLI backup utility via which you’ll have the ability to perform both local and distant backups in a secure and efficient means.
  • Rsync will delete partially transferred information attributable to network glitches or different interruptions.
  • You can add the above command to your script or make a separate script just for remote backups.
  • Basically, these three options mean to preserve all the attributes of your information.
  • The –compare-dest choice is not going to accept a distant directory.

Tips On How To Enhance Rsync Pace For Large Recordsdata

To keep away from confusion, I removed the two beforehand copied directories from the exterior drive earlier than this second command was executed. If we take a glance at the external USB drive, we see the directories which are in the Paperwork directory have been copied to the foundation of the external drive. /mnt/ it’s critical to exclude them if we connect a USB memory. Rsync is broadly considered one of the best tools for file synchronization on Linux because of its speed and suppleness. Whereas there are alternate options like Unison, Rsync’s strong datenredundanz options make it a best choice for lots of customers. This desk presents key ideas for optimizing Rsync performance, serving to customers to achieve faster and more dependable file synchronization and backups.

The Method To Install And Configure Jenkins On Ubuntu 2404

In this command, `-server` must be changed along with your actual username and the distant server’s IP handle or area name. Knowledge from your NAS could be backed up offsite to a distant website for extra safety. You can use the Remote Sync function found underneath the Backup & Restore system app to back up your NAS to both one other ASUSTOR NAS or an Rsync appropriate server. The primary function of offsite backup is for catastrophe recovery in the occasion of environmental disasters, theft, and exhausting disk or different mechanical failures.

Using Rsync Over A Community

You can see in the screenshot that rsync mechanically detected the model new file. Let’s say you may have 10,000 files in a folder and only 20 of them modified today. An incremental backup will skip the 9,980 unchanged files and only again up the 20 that actually modified, which is environment friendly and ideal for day by day backups. In this command, -a stands for “archive mode”, which ensures that symbolic links, devices, attributes, permissions, ownerships, etc., are preserved within the vacation spot. The -v flag stands for “verbose”, offering detailed output of the process.

Insurance,
Re-Imagined

At your fingertips, get the App